An in-depth investigation of what lives inside the human belly button uncovers hundreds of organisms...

...our closest relationships in life are with the still mysterious, ultra tiny organisms. "They are partners more intimate than our lovers, children, pets or any other organisms," Dunn said. "You are covered in unknown life. That life is doing things for or to you. Don't you feel like you should know about it?"
